Well you're still young for the menopause proper, but believe it or not, hot flushes can happen up to 10 years before the periods stop altogether...its called the peri-menopause and hot flushes are normally the first sign. I'm like you, ive never had the problem of sweating throughout my life, not even in my teens so my hot flushes come without the sweat fortunately..but I can still wake up at 5am feeling really hot and have to throw off the covers. This was one of the first symptoms around age 44, and has been one of the last and i'm now 56, my periods stopped when i was 50. Have a chat to either your doctor or one of the practice nurses about it.
